Pedro GonzalezAn old colleague I had not heard from in a long while added me to a group chat on Wednesday. The members were all people who had been in my cohort for the Claremont Institute’s Lincoln Fellowship in 2021, a mixture of media figures, analysts, and activists. Although the group sort of fragmented later, I did make a few good friends with whom I kept in touch even after I began removing myself from that social circle. Still, I thought it was odd. Why now, and why add me after years of silence?

“Charlie got shot.”

Charlie Kirk had been in my Lincoln Fellow class. That was how we first met, and that was how I appeared on his show and spoke at one of his events, before our paths diverged. I opened X just as the headlines were starting to appear on the feed. Someone shot him while he was on tour at Utah Valley University. …
